Unlocking Clarity: Features That Truly Matter
When evaluating options, consider these critical elements that differentiate effective solutions from mere gadgets.
- Cross-over Technology: Look for systems designed to pick up sound from your deaf side and wirelessly transmit it to a receiver in your hearing ear. This helps your brain process sound as if it’s coming from both sides.
- Comfort and Discretion: Since you’ll be wearing these devices for extended periods, their fit and how they blend into your daily life are paramount. Consider both behind-the-ear and in-the-ear styles.
- Battery Life: Assess how long the devices can operate on a single charge or battery replacement. Convenience and reliability are key for consistent use.
- Connectivity Options: Modern hearing aids often offer Bluetooth connectivity, allowing direct streaming from phones or other devices. This can significantly enhance your listening experience.
- Professional Fitting and Support: The expertise of an audiologist is crucial for proper programming and ongoing adjustments, ensuring optimal performance and your satisfaction.
Avoiding the Wrong Turn: Common Missteps to Sidestep
Even with the best intentions, it’s easy to overlook crucial details. Be mindful of these potential pitfalls.
- Ignoring the Trial Period: Don’t commit to a device without fully utilizing any offered trial period. Your experience in real-world situations is invaluable.
- Underestimating the Role of an Audiologist: Self-fitting or purchasing without professional guidance can lead to suboptimal results and frustration.
- Focusing Solely on Price: While budget is a factor, prioritizing the lowest cost over features and personalized support can ultimately lead to dissatisfaction and a less effective solution.
